FROM THE AIRPORT
A taxi from the Canberra Airport
to the Australian National University will cost approximately twenty
dollars. Canberra Cabs can be contacted on (02) 6215 8500.
For information on timetables and
fares for buses to and from the airport, visit Deane’s Buslines website
www.deanesbuslines.com.au/airliner.htm, telephone them on (02) 6299
3722 or email
admin@deanesbuslines.com.au. Buses travel to and from the airport
from Canberra City approximately every hour, Monday to Friday and the
journey time is approximately 20 minutes.
BY CAR
Travel south along
Northbourne Avenue, then turn right onto Barry Drive. Turn left into
the Australian National University Campus at the traffic lights next
to the oval, Take the first right-hand turn. This is Daley Road. Follow
this road until you reach a small roundabout. Turn left at this roundabout,
then take the next right turn (this is still Daley Road). Turn left
onto Ward Road. Follow this road along and it will become Garran Road.
Follow this road through the intersection, going straight ahead onto
McCoy Circuit. Follow McCoy Circuit through the roundabout into Gordon
Street. You will see the Shine Dome across the road from Screen Sound
Australia. There are many parking stations on the way to the Shine Dome,
where parking is not available. This parking costs approximately $5.00
for the entire day. To view this route on the map of ANU, go to the
Maps section.
